What Can I Expect to Catch Offshore?
When you go bluewater fishing in Alabama's Gulf Coast, either through a fishing charter or deep-sea fishing, you have a chance to land some of the best gamefish around, including:
- Snapper - plentiful and great eating
- Yellowfin tuna - popular fish to target, renowned for its flavor
- Blackfin tuna - will take your bait deep when hooked
- Grouper - prefers deep water near natural or manmade structures
- Wahoo - a fast-swimming fighter
If you're in search of the trophy photo of a lifetime, blue marlin is the king of game fish and can be found in Orange Beach and Gulf Shores. Its smaller leaping cousin, white marlin, is also found in the deep Gulf waters along with the tail-dancing Atlantic sailfish. Check out our seasonal fishing page.
What Can I Expect to Catch Inshore?
The sun rising over the tranquil waters of the back bays offers a different and equally thrilling fishing experience. Anglers exploring the coastal bays and estuaries are likely to encounter:
- Speckled and white trout - ferocious in attacking baits
- Flounder - found near piers and structures
- Redfish - prized shallow water fighting game fish
- Mackerel - plentiful warm water coastal fish
- Cobia/Crab eaters - migratory fish caught just off the beaches.
If you're in search of a real fishing story, go after barracuda. These are fierce fighters with teeth to match: making for a promising battle between man and fish.
Fishing Types on the Alabama Gulf Coast
Charter Fishing
With a fleet of over a hundred fishing charter boats heading out into the Gulf and back bays daily, booking a fishing excursion is easy. Once aboard, experienced captains will get you to your fish and show you how to hook your trophy. Private party fishing charters and walk-on group charters are available. Bait, tackle and fishing licenses are provided as part of the fishing charter package. All you have to do is sit back and enjoy the fishing experience of a lifetime.
